数据库是现代信息系统中不可或缺的组成部分,高效的数据入库操作对于保证数据处理的效率和质量至关重要。本文将详细介绍如何通过一键点击的方式,轻松实现数据的入库操作,并分享一些高效数据库操作的技巧。
1. 一键点击数据入库的实现原理
一键点击数据入库通常依赖于以下技术:
- 自动化脚本:通过编写自动化脚本,可以将数据入库操作自动化,实现一键触发。
- 图形化界面:开发一个图形化界面,用户只需点击按钮即可触发数据入库流程。
- 数据库连接池:使用数据库连接池技术,可以减少数据库连接的开销,提高数据入库效率。
以下是一个简单的Python脚本示例,用于实现一键点击数据入库:
import sqlite3
def insert_data(data):
conn = sqlite3.connect('example.db')
cursor = conn.cursor()
cursor.execute('CREATE TABLE IF NOT EXISTS data (id INTEGER PRIMARY KEY, value TEXT)')
cursor.execute('INSERT INTO data (value) VALUES (?)', (data,))
conn.commit()
conn.close()
# 假设这是用户点击按钮后触发的函数
def on_button_click():
data_to_insert = "示例数据"
insert_data(data_to_insert)
on_button_click()
2. 高效数据库操作技巧
2.1 优化SQL语句
- *避免使用SELECT **:只选择需要的列,减少数据传输量。
- 使用索引:合理使用索引可以显著提高查询效率。
- 批量操作:使用批量插入或更新操作,减少数据库访问次数。
2.2 数据库连接管理
- 使用连接池:减少连接创建和销毁的开销,提高系统性能。
- 合理配置连接池参数:根据系统负载调整连接池大小,避免资源浪费。
2.3 数据库备份与恢复
- 定期备份:定期备份数据库,防止数据丢失。
- 选择合适的备份策略:根据业务需求选择合适的备份策略,如全量备份、增量备份等。
2.4 性能监控与优化
- 监控数据库性能:定期监控数据库性能,及时发现并解决瓶颈。
- 优化查询语句:针对慢查询进行优化,提高查询效率。
3. 总结
通过一键点击的方式实现数据入库,可以大大简化操作流程,提高工作效率。同时,掌握一些高效数据库操作技巧,可以帮助我们更好地管理和维护数据库。在实际应用中,应根据具体业务需求和技术环境,灵活运用这些技巧,以实现最佳的数据管理效果。
